If anyone had stopped and asked Sam to give him a ride at that moment, chances were he would've said no.
However, no one was going to stop for him. The only thing the 19 year old had on him was his wallet. No backpack, no duffel bag. Nothing. Despite the fact that he was walking down the side of the highway, the kid had nothing to his name.
Why? Well, that was the biggest part of the reason Sam wouldn't have accepted a ride from anyone. It was 2014. Eight years froward in time from where Sam was supposed to be. Where he had been.
The events of his day - had it even been a day? - had been a big mess. Some guy with strawberry blonde hair, and a moustache of a completely different color had told him to trust him. Told him that it was better this way. Told him that if he could, he'd thank him later.
But, as Sam meandered down the highway in the middle of nowhere, he couldn't imagine one reason why he'd thank him. You see, since his sudden shift, Sam had been nearly committed, on a bus for 5 hours, and left in the middle of flat, blank, nowhere Kansas hoping to maybe find someone that he knew.
It was the best shot he had. Dean would probably be in Kansas, right? Or maybe their dad? Maybe he shouldn't have paid all that money for a bus ticket to Kansas. Maybe he should've gone to Sioux Falls and shown up on Bobby's doorstep. Surely that old man would know exactly what to do, or how to contact his family.
As that thought ran through his head, Sam went off on the tangent of possibilities. Dean and John probably thought he was dead, or worse: cutting them off. Sure, he'd been pissed when he left for college... But, he'd never forsake his family. No matter how they treated him.
That was why Sam's first thought was to get to Dean. He needed to see him. Immediately.
